What's the right Oil-gas mixture for an '88" 15hp Evinrude. I have no idea how to do this, it's my first time.....please specify exacly how many ounces per gallon

Re: gas mixture

That needs a 50:1 ratio mix, Alex.<br /><br />One pint of TC-W3 rated outboard oil to 6 gallons of 87 octane unleaded gas is 48:1, which is plenty close enough.<br /><br />On a per gallon basis, that is 2.56oz. per gallon.<br /><br />Good luck. :)

Re: gas mixture

Or, to give you even more information than you asked for - based on the nearly universal size of gas cans (not boat tanks) 13 oz per 5 gal. This is what I use because I end up carrying a lot of gas in 5 gal. cans, and have a marked container to dispense 13 oz. If you mix a pt. per 5 gallons it's 40:1 which a lot of people think is also an acceptable mixture. I've run a lot of 40:1 and haven't really had any noticable problems at all. As he said, 50:1 is the proper mixture, but if you err on the side of a little too much oil (e.g. somewhere between 40:1 and 50:1) you'll probably have no problems at all.
